The ED’s findings in the alleged Tirupati laddu adulteration case point to a large-scale, meticulously planned, systemic adulteration over five years of the previous YSRCP government, TDP leader Jyosthna Tirunagari alleged on Saturday.
Following the recent arrest of Kailash Chand Mangla of Sukriti Foods,Tirunagari claimed that adulterated ghee worth Rs 230 crore was supplied to TTD between 2019 and 2024.
“The ED’s findings point to a deeply disturbing pattern: nearly Rs 230 crore worth of adulterated ghee was allegedly supplied to TTD between 2019 and 2024. This was not an isolated incident – it indicates large-scale, meticulously planned, systemic adulteration over five years of the previous YSRCP government that demands full accountability,” she told PTI.
According to the probe agency, the ghee used to prepare the world famous ‘Tirupati Laddu’ was allegedly made using refined palm oil, palmolein and various chemicals.
